Winter Skin Care Tips
As we all know, winter can be extremely hard on skin. Especially to those who are already afflicted with dry, itchy skin. The above infographic gives 10 quick tips, and below you’ll find even more details on what we feel are the most important steps.
Don’t Forget the Sunscreen -
Sunscreen again? Yes. Sunscreen isn’t just a summer requirement; it’s actually necessary to apply sunscreen year round. You need sunscreen on a sunny day, a cloudy day, and even if you are just going to spend the whole day at the office (fluorescent lights actually emit UV rays). So put on some sunscreen and remember to reapply when you’re going to be staying outside for long periods of time. Yes, you can get sunburned even in the winter.

Stay Away from Super Hot Baths -
Super hot baths might be nice in the wintertime, but they are bad for your skin and should be a no-no in your winter skin care routine. Hot water strips your skin of the natural oils and moisture, and more so as you turn up the heat in the shower or in the tub. Instead, go for shorter lukewarm baths or, if you can handle it, cooler baths. You should also apply the right moisturizer after you bathe.
Turn on the Humidifiers -
Humidifiers aren’t just for babies. During the wintertime it’s a good idea to fire up the humidifiers inside your home. In fact, if you have a couple of them, you should distribute them around the house for better humidification. The humidity in the air will keep your skin from drying out. Remember that it is possible to put too much humidity into the air however. If you see condensation on the inside of your windows, it’s time to dial back the humidity. The colder it is outside, the lower the humidity you’ll safely be able to keep your house at without risking mold.
